The BC Craft Farmers Co-Op planning committee for the 2024 BC Craft Cannabis Summit is excited to announce more speakers for the event happening in Prince George from April 19th to 21st.

Earlier this month BCCFC confirmed MP Patrick Weiler and Dr. Susan Dupej and Mike Schilling, CEO and John Conroy, K.C. as keynote speakers.

Today we are pleased to confirm three new speakers:

BC Craft Cannabis Keynote Speaker: MaYor Simon Yu

Image courtesy of: Prince George City Hall

Mayor Simon Yu

Mayor Yu has been an active member of the Prince George Community for nearly 50 years with a scope of work and community involvement that includes: Director for University of Northern British Columbia and Director for the Prince George Airport Authority.

BC Craft Cannabis Keynote Speaker: Tyson Wall, Craft Farmer

Image courtesy of: Kush Mountain

Tyson Wall, BC Craft Farmer, Co-Founder, Kush Mountain

Tyson epitomizes excellence in the craft cannabis industry. As a licensed micro-cultivation and processing facility, Kush Mountain specializes in curating high-quality craft “BC Bud.” With his deep industry knowledge and unwavering commitment to quality, Tyson is poised to make an impact at the BC Craft Cannabis Summit. Scheduled to speak at 9:00am on Saturday as part of the “Perspectives: The Front Line of BC Cannabis” session, Tyson will distill years of industry experience into an insightful talk. Attendees can anticipate valuable insights into the challenges and opportunities facing BC cannabis producers directly from the front line.
